Insignis Therapeutics


Insignis Therapeutics is a privately held specialty pharmaceutical company focused on developing innovative allergy and anaphylaxis treatments. The company is dedicated to creating groundbreaking, safe, and effective treatments such as the IN-001 liquid epinephrine sublingual spray, which aims to revolutionize the treatment of severe allergic reactions including anaphylaxis. Their mission is to develop oral versions of epinephrine auto-injectors to help people with severe allergies live with greater freedom and confidence. They leverage advanced technology and scientific expertise to improve the quality of life for patients worldwide through innovative, effective, and accessible medical solutions.

Products

Investigational sublingual epinephrine liquid spray (investigational)

An investigational liquid formulation for sublingual administration of epinephrine (prodrug-based) housed in a unit-dose disposable spray device intended as an emergency rescue medication for anaphylaxis.

News & Updates

The FDA grants Fast Track status to IN-001, a needle-free, stable, and easy-to-use liquid epinephrine spray for emergency treatment of anaphylaxis, addressing unmet medical needs.

Phase 1 clinical study demonstrates rapid absorption, sustained efficacy, and safety of IN-001, with superior performance compared to existing products.

The study showed rapid absorption within 9 minutes, plasma levels above 100 pg/mL for 2 hours, and a good safety profile.
